## Indications for Use

The BIT-Motion is a stand-alone image post processing software. The Bit-Motion is intended for use as a PACS device, which is interfaced to the clinics' LAN. It receives clinical studies from hospital modalities, processes functional volumetric data and generates parametric maps that display changes intensity. It also includes manual display manipulation, annotation and control tools, which assist professional users to evaluate the displayed maps and to transfer the results to the PACS, in DICOM format. The BIT-Motion indications for use are receiving breast studies from MRI scanners and processing them to generate DTI (Diffusion Tensor Imaging) 2D and 3D parametric maps that display changes in the values of water diffusion coefficients and directions, as well as in indices defining diffusion anisotropy. The device-displayed DTI parametric maps are evaluated by the users. The device is indicated for use by trained radiologists and may provide information on breast water diffusion features. The BIT-Motion should not be used in isolation breast tissue features or for making patient management decisions.

## Device Story

Stand-alone image post-processing software; operates on PC server connected to clinic LAN. Receives breast MRI datasets in DICOM format from hospital scanners; processes functional volumetric data to generate DTI 2D/3D parametric maps (water diffusion coefficients, directions, anisotropy indices). Provides manual display manipulation, annotation, and control tools for radiologists to evaluate maps; transfers results to PACS in DICOM format. Used in clinical settings by trained radiologists to assist in evaluating breast water diffusion features. Does not provide automated diagnosis; output serves as supplemental information for physician evaluation; not for use in isolation for patient management decisions.

## Clinical Evidence

Bench testing only. Software verified via predefined test plan; performance validated using MRI dedicated phantom. Usability and reliability validated in end-user environment. No clinical trial data presented.

## Technological Characteristics

Software package running on off-the-shelf PC server; Microsoft Windows 10 OS. Standard MMI (screen, keyboard, mouse). Inputs/outputs: DICOM MRI studies. Connectivity: Networked via LAN. Risk management per ISO 14971.

## Regulatory Identification

A medical image management and processing system is a device that provides one or more capabilities relating to the review and digital processing of medical images for the purposes of interpretation by a trained practitioner of disease detection, diagnosis, or patient management. The software components may provide advanced or complex image processing functions for image manipulation, enhancement, or quantification that are intended for use in the interpretation and analysis of medical images. Advanced image manipulation functions may include image segmentation, multimodality image registration, or 3D visualization. Complex quantitative functions may include semi-automated measurements or time-series measurements.

#### Device Description

The BIT-Motion is a software package that is aimed to process MRI images. The software runs on a PC server, which is connected to the Local Area Network (LAN). The device receives MRI datasets from MRI scanner over the network in DICOM format, processes the images and transfers the outcome images in DICOM format, to selected PCAS stations.

#### Technological Characteristics

The BIT-Motion software package is installed in an off-the-shelf PC server, which include Man Machine Interface (standard screen, keyboard and mouse). The Operating System is Microsoft W10. The software package consists of the following software modules: The Communication, User Interface, Algorithm, and graphical tools. Data inputs and output are MRI studies in DICOM format.

## Performance Tests

#### Non-Clinical tests

Conforming to 21CFR820.30(f) requirements, the device software has been verified by testing the software following predefined software test plan.

In addition, the device performance has been verified, by testing it using MRI dedicated phantom.

Conforming to 21CFR820.30(g) requirements, the device performance, usability and reliability have been validated by testing the device in end-user environment.

The above testing methods adhered to state-of-art standards and procedures. The tests' results demonstrate that the device output meet the design input and the intended use.

## Risk Management

The device risks were managed and controlled following the requirements of ISO 14971standard. The device hazards were identified, their risk levels were evaluated and mitigation measures were taken to reduce the risk levels. In DDE opinion the benefits of the BIT-Motion outcome, overweight the device residual risks.

#### Substantial Equivalence conclusion

The BIT-Motion has the same intended use and very similar indication for use as the legally marketed predicate device. The two devices have similar technological characteristics. Results of tests, which were adhered to state-of-art standards and procedures, demonstrate that differences in the technological characteristics do not raise new questions of safety or effectiveness. Based on this discussion, it is DDE's opinion that BIT-Motion is substantially equivalent in terms of safety and effectiveness to the CADstream Version 4.0 (K043216) predicate device.
